Mudah digunakan pustaka ini untuk membangun widget gambar jaringan, Anda dapat membangun tata letak yang berbeda sesuai dengan kesalahan/beban, juga mengatur delegasi cache gambar.
ok_image : ^0.4.0 import "package:ok_image/ok_image.dart" ; import "package:ok_image/ok_image.dart" ;
createWidget (){
return OKImage (
url : "https://ws1.sinaimg.cn/large/844036b9ly1fxfo76hzd4j20zk0nc48i.jpg" ,
width : 200 ,
height : 200 ,
timeout : Duration (seconds : 20 ),
fit : fit,
);
}url: image net url
width: width
height: height
fit: show BoxFit
followRedirects: whether image redirection is allowed.
loadingWidget: display on loading
errorWidget: display when image load error / timeout.
retry: retry to load image count.
timeout: timeout duration.
onErrorTap: when loadErrorWidget show ,onTap it.
cacheDelegate: you can use the param to delegate loadImageEksperimental: Tanda tangan, nilai pengembalian, parameter, dan informasi lainnya dapat dimodifikasi di masa depan.
onLoadStateChanged: will be call on the load state changed. Edit OKImage.buildErrorWidget untuk mengkonfigurasi global okimage errorWidget.
Edit OKImage.buildLoadingWidget untuk mengonfigurasi pemuatan global okimage.
di bawah BSD 3:
Apache 2.0:
Terima kasih kepada Open Source.
Jika Anda menggunakan versi yang lebih lama dari perpustakaan open source ini, yang menyebabkan ketidakcocokan, harap perbarui. Jika tidak sesuai dengan saya, silakan hubungi saya dan saya akan memperbarui nomor versi bila perlu.